- Dimax2 / Dimax3 calibration files will be named based on the sensor's serial number,
  to make sure that correct calibration file is used. In some cases Dimaxis gives warning 
  about this after pan or ceph exposure. To get rid of the message, the calibration file 
  should be renamed, or the sensor should be recalibrated. 
  Old format: Dimax2Promax.p4.cal
  New format (example): RD1234567.p4.cal
- Correction to Dixi and Dixi2 maximum exposure time. There was a problem if times longer
  than two seconds (2048 ms) were used.

  - There used to be two different versions of the Dixi2 PCI device driver MDILL.sys:
    one that uses IRQ and one that doesn't. Now they are combined. The usage of IRQ
    can be defined using DidapiConfig program. IRQ is required for Proline pan/ceph
    and for Dixi2/Dixi with Planmeca Intra (to get the exposure values from intra)
  - The files i386null.sys ja i386null.inf are no longer needed. They took care of 
    an unused function in the PCI card; it is now taken care by MDILL.INF.

4.1.1 	Release notes (2005/12/02)
        - 4.1.0 TWAIN/DIDAPI installation program contained a file 'imagearc.dll' that is not needed in
          TWAIN or DIDAPI interfaces !! Imagearc.dll 4.1.0 is not compatible Dimaxis 4.0.2 or older and caused
          Dimaxis 4.0.2 or older to crash if and when only DIDAPI drivers were updated (but not Dimaxis). 
          Dimaxis and imagearc.dll should always have same version numbers. In that case manual copying of original
          imagearc.dll that is compatible with Dimaxis version will fix the Dimaxis problem. 


4.1.0  Release notes (2005/11/11)
            - installation program wrote Configuration File Path without directory separator ('\' character)
              at the end of the string. It caused problems in DidapiConfig program.   
            - in some cases TWAIN installation updated the system environment variable 'Path' using wrong 
              string type in the registry. The correct type is expanded string REG_EXPAND_SZ.
              (old installation can be corrected manually e.g. adding ';' character at the end of the 'Path' 
               string. Use Control Panel/System/Advanced/Environment Variable and save the edited string)

=========================
SETUP Program installs 
=========================

I. All Planmecas Drivers  
   - WinNT4:
      - Dixi/Dixi2/Dimax2/Dimax3 driver 'mdill_nt.sys', Dimax1 driver 'Dimlp_nt.sys'
        and .reg files are installed into  <WINSYSDIR>\drivers folder.

      - Drivers are registered automatically by 'regini.exe' program.

      - The computer must be rebooted (or driver must be started manually).

   - 2000/XP:
      - Dixi USB drivers 'Dixi2USB.sys','Pmloader.sys', Dixi/Dixi2/Dimax2/Dimax3 drivers
        'mdill.sys','i386sull.sys' are installed into <WINSYSDIR>\drivers folder.
 
      - corresponding .inf files are installed into <WINDIR>\inf folder.

      - The computer must be rebooted to enable plug-and-play function.

      - Dixi2 Ethernet initialization file 'Dixi2EthernetCfg.txt' and configuration 
        program 'DixiETHcfg.exe' are copied into Didapi path folder, or created by
        'DidapiConfig.exe' program
 

II.DIDAPI dynamic libraries, programs and ini- control file
   - 'didapi.dll', 'dimli.dll', 'dimlp.dll', 'DIXI.lut', 'jpeg_12.dll'
      'jpeg_8.dll'and auxiliary programs for DIDAPI are installed into the <TARGERDIR> folder 
      ('C:\<Program Files>\didapi' by default)

   - Planmeca device setting programs files are installed also into <TARGETDIR> folder 

   - 'didapi.ini' control file is installed into <WINDIR> folder


III. Registry and other stuff
   - The path of didapi files is added to the 'Path'/'PATH' environment variable. 
     (in the registry of WinME/NT/2000/XP, a new PATH line into autoexec.bat in Win98).
   - Planmeca folder is added into Startup menu. Folder contains links to Planmeca device
     setting programs and a link to this 'readme.txt' file 



NOTE ! Unistallation will not delete didapi path from 'Path' environment variable 
     It must be deleted manually.


NOTE !  Installation/Uninstallation creates a log  file
	'DidapiKit__<date>.log' into the system folder <WINDIR>. (WINNT or WINDOWS) 

	'HKEY_LOCAL_MACHINE\SOFTWARE\Planmeca\DidapiKit' key will contain a 'DidapiKitPath' string variable.
    		Variable keeps the installation folder path.
